National Shakespeare Competition

Once again Camden High School students have outdone themselves.  Most schools are proud to have two or three students compete in this rigorous event where students must recite a Shakespearean passage without using any props or wearing costumes. This year our school had 22 students compete, which is 7 more than last year.  Obviously directors, Edkin and DePerno-Zahas are inspiring our students.
